Langhe White Blend

Gaja Rossj Bass is a captivating white blend from the renowned Langhe region, celebrated for its pristine and energetic nature. This delightful wine features a medium-bodied profile with a refreshing quality that tantalizes the palate. The acidity is vibrant, offering a bright and mouthwatering experience that elevates its overall appeal. The fruit intensity shines through with prominent notes of ripe peaches, crisp green apples, and delicate citrus, harmoniously intertwining to create a luscious flavor profile. With its dry character, Gaja Rossj Bass is a perfect companion for various culinary delights, enhancing the dining experience with its exquisite balance and finesse. This wine truly embodies the essence of the Langhe region, showcasing the artistry and dedication of its winemakers.

While France takes the crown for the most famous wines styles and grape varieties, Italy is where wine was first perfected. The ancient Greeks called it Oenotria—"land of the vines"—and the Roman Empire advanced grape growing and winemaking to a level of quality we still enjoy today. But behind Italy's best-known wines, such as Chianti, Barolo and prosecco, there's an almost endless diversity of delights awaiting the intrepid explorer. The key to understanding Italian wine is regionality and (of course) food. From the aromatic and sparkling whites of the north to Sicily's rich and spicy reds, Italy offers wine lovers a lifetime of gastronomic treats.
